The 2022-2023 property tax rate has been set by the Town Assessor, committed on Aug. 25, 2022. The Town of Scarborough’s new tax rate is now set at $15.39 per $1,000 of property value for the 2023 fiscal year, which runs from July 1, 2022 to June 30, 2023. The new rate applies to the […]

Georgia woman died on privately maintained path
A Georgia woman visiting Maine spent the morning before her 55th birthday walking a private path along the cliffs of Scarborough that has been used by the public for centuries. Just before 10:30 a.m. Monday, Romona Gowens of Calhoun, Georgia, fell from a 30-foot cliff after a fence she was leaning on broke, police said. […]
